In the rapidly evolving world of digital entertainment, pattern recognition and data analysis have become essential tools for crafting immersive, responsive, and engaging gaming experiences. From rendering visuals to guiding artificial intelligence, understanding how data-driven patterns influence game mechanics offers insights into the future of interactive storytelling and player engagement. In this article, we explore the foundational concepts behind data patterns in gaming, their technical implementations, and how modern titles like x5000 max shown centre screen serve as contemporary illustrations of these principles.

Table of Contents

1. Introduction to Pattern Recognition and Data in Gaming

Patterns are recurring structures or sequences that help us make sense of complex systems. In gaming, recognizing these patterns is crucial for understanding how virtual worlds operate, how players behave, and how game mechanics can be optimized for better engagement. For example, the way an NPC (non-player character) reacts to a player’s actions often follows discernible behavioral patterns that can be analyzed to improve AI performance.

Data analysis plays a pivotal role in modern game development. By collecting vast amounts of gameplay data—such as player movements, choices, and reaction times—developers can identify patterns that inform design decisions. This process enhances user experience by making game worlds more responsive and narratives more personalized.

Pattern recognition not only streamlines technical processes but also enriches storytelling. For instance, understanding common player strategies allows designers to craft challenges that are both fair and stimulating, creating a dynamic narrative environment that adapts to player skill levels.

Explore further:

2. Foundations of Data-Driven Modeling in Games

At the core of modern game development lies the systematic collection and processing of data from virtual environments. Developers utilize sensors and logging systems to gather information about player actions, environmental variables, and system performance. This raw data is then processed through algorithms that identify meaningful patterns.

These algorithms interpret data to optimize rendering processes, AI behaviors, and user interactions. For example, machine learning models analyze player movement patterns to predict next actions, enabling NPCs to respond more naturally and strategically. Such pattern detection is fundamental to creating immersive worlds that feel alive and reactive.

3. Technical Algorithms Shaping Visual and Computational Aspects

a. Depth perception and rendering: The Z-buffer algorithm as a pattern recognition tool

The Z-buffer algorithm is essential in 3D rendering, serving as a pattern recognition method to determine visible surfaces in a scene. It stores depth information for each pixel, allowing the system to compare and decide which surfaces should be rendered in front of others. This process ensures realistic visuals by accurately depicting spatial relationships.

By efficiently managing depth data, the Z-buffer enhances rendering speed and visual fidelity—crucial for high-performance games where seamless visuals contribute directly to player immersion.

b. Pathfinding and AI navigation: Dijkstra’s algorithm as a pattern-finding method

Dijkstra’s algorithm calculates the shortest path between points in complex terrains, enabling NPCs and players to navigate efficiently. This pattern-finding technique considers the entire map, identifying optimal routes that adapt dynamically as environments change, such as when obstacles are introduced or removed.

Enhanced pathfinding results in more believable NPC behaviors and better guidance systems, which are vital for strategic gameplay and maintaining a sense of realism.

c. Randomization and procedural generation: Linear Congruential Generators

Linear Congruential Generators (LCGs) are algorithms used to produce pseudorandom sequences, forming the backbone of procedural content generation. This approach enables developers to create varied environments, items, and events that appear different each playthrough, enhancing replayability.

Pattern-based content variation ensures players encounter unique challenges, maintaining engagement and curiosity over time.

4. Case Study: Olympian Legends – A Modern Illustration of Pattern Utilization

Olympian Legends exemplifies how data-driven techniques underpin game mechanics and storytelling. Developers analyze player interactions to refine visual rendering, AI behaviors, and procedural content, creating a rich, immersive experience grounded in pattern recognition.

For instance, visual rendering optimizations inspired by depth algorithms like the Z-buffer allow for stunning, realistic scenes that react seamlessly to player perspectives. Pathfinding algorithms emulate real athletic routes, providing NPCs with strategic movement that mirrors human decision-making.

Procedural content, such as random events and challenges, keep players engaged by ensuring that no two experiences are exactly alike, leveraging pattern-based variation to sustain interest and challenge.

a. Visual rendering improvements

Using depth perception algorithms, the game’s graphics engine dynamically adjusts scene complexity, ensuring high-fidelity visuals without sacrificing performance. This balance is crucial in large-scale environments that demand both detail and efficiency.

b. Pathfinding and AI strategies

AI opponents and NPCs adopt routes and strategies that reflect real-world athletic tactics, thanks to pattern recognition in navigation algorithms. This creates more believable and strategic interactions, elevating the competitive aspect of the game.

c. Procedural content and random events

Dynamic random events generated through pattern-based algorithms keep gameplay unpredictable and fresh, encouraging repeated playthroughs and deepening player engagement.

5. Beyond the Basics: Advanced Pattern Recognition and Data Insights

As game technology advances, machine learning and AI analyze vast datasets to personalize player experiences. For example, adaptive difficulty settings modify challenges based on detected skill levels, creating a tailored experience that maintains engagement.

Detecting emergent patterns—such as collective player behaviors—allows developers to balance gameplay dynamically and predict game outcomes, contributing to more equitable and enjoyable experiences.

However, ethical considerations arise regarding data collection. Transparency and privacy safeguards are essential to ensure that pattern analysis respects player rights while enhancing the gaming experience.

6. Non-Obvious Depths: The Impact of Data Patterns on Player Psychology and Engagement

Complex pattern design influences how players perceive and immerse themselves in a game. Subtle cues and recurring motifs guide decision-making and foster a sense of mastery. For example, consistent visual or auditory patterns can subconsciously influence players’ choices, increasing satisfaction and confidence.

In Olympian Legends, for example, players encounter pattern-based challenges that adapt to their skill level, encouraging strategic thinking and player adaptation. Such design leverages psychological principles rooted in pattern recognition to deepen engagement.

“Understanding and designing data patterns is key to creating meaningful player experiences that are both challenging and rewarding.”

7. Future Perspectives: Evolving Data Technologies and Gaming Realities

The integration of real-time data analytics promises adaptive game environments that respond instantaneously to player actions. As pattern recognition algorithms become more sophisticated, virtual worlds will feel increasingly lifelike, with NPCs that learn and evolve alongside players.

Potential breakthroughs include the development of more nuanced AI behaviors and procedural generation techniques that create vast, diverse worlds with minimal developer input. This evolution will blur the line between scripted content and emergent gameplay, fostering a new era of immersive storytelling.

Ongoing dialogue between data science and narrative design will be essential in shaping these innovations, ensuring that technological advances serve to deepen player engagement and emotional connection.

8. Conclusion: Unlocking the Power of Data Patterns to Understand and Create Games

Data patterns are the invisible threads weaving together visual fidelity, strategic complexity, and player experience. By mastering pattern recognition, developers can craft worlds that are both believable and captivating, tailored to individual players’ journeys.

Interdisciplinary approaches—combining algorithms, storytelling, and psychology—are vital in this endeavor. As the gaming landscape continues to evolve, embracing data-driven insights will be essential for creating immersive, meaningful experiences.

“The future of gaming lies in understanding the patterns that bind worlds, stories, and players together.”

Leave a Reply

Your email address will not be published. Required fields are marked *